Role of Escherichia coli K capsular antigens during complement activation, C3 fixation, and opsonization.
Escherichia coli strains with K capsular polysaccharides are relatively resistant to phagocytosis by polymorphonuclear leukocytes, in contrast to E. coli strains without K antigens.
